Oregon Statutes - Chapter 420 - Youth Correction Facilities; Youth Care Centers - Section 420.060 - Employment agreements; definitions.

(1) Upon finding that the education and training of a youth offender placed in a youth correction facility will be furthered if the youth offender is permitted to work at gainful employment on a temporary basis, the superintendent may enter into an agreement with any suitable person or business establishment for the temporary employment of the youth offender.

(2) For the purposes of ORS 420.060 to 420.074, “youth correction facility” includes youth care centers as defined in ORS 420.855 and approved by the Oregon Youth Authority pursuant to ORS 420.865, and “superintendent” includes the person in charge of any such youth care center. [1969 c.410 §1; 1971 c.401 §103; 1995 c.422 §97]
